Are you investing in supplements to boost your fitness journey? While supplements can be a great addition to a balanced diet and exercise routine, assessing their effectiveness is crucial to ensure you're reaching your goals efficiently. Here’s a guide to help you evaluate the impact of your supplements.

Table of Contents

1. Set Clear Goals

Before adding supplements to your regimen, it's essential to set precise goals. Whether you're aiming to increase muscle mass, improve endurance, or enhance recovery, having specific objectives will help you measure progress effectively.

2. Monitor Physical Changes

Track improvements in physical performance, such as increased strength, stamina, or recovery speed. Use a journal or an app to record changes in workout performance or body composition over time.

3. Consistency is Key

To evaluate any supplement, a consistent intake as per the recommended dosage is necessary. This ensures that the results you observe are due to the supplement and not other external factors.

4. Analyze Diet and Nutrition

Supplements are most effective when they complement a well-rounded diet. Assess your nutritional intake to ensure that the supplements are not overlapping with your dietary sources but filling in nutritional gaps.

5. Consult with a Professional

If you're unsure about how a particular supplement is affecting your health, it might be beneficial to consult a healthcare professional or nutritionist. They can provide personalized advice based on your health status and goals.

7. Be Patient

Supplements are not a quick fix. It takes time to notice significant changes, so be patient and give your body enough time to respond.
